How many ounces in a quart?

There are three types of quarts, US Customary fluid and dry quarts and the Imperial quart. There are two types of fluid ounces, US Customary fluid ounce and the Imperial fluid ounce. So, depending on what types of quarts and fluid ounces are used, the answer to the question of how many fluid ounces in a quart might be different. If you are converting from US fluid quarts to US fluid ounces, then there are 32 fluid ounces in a quart. If the conversion is between Imperial quarts and Imperial fluid ounces, then there are 40 Imperial fluid ounces in an Imperial quart.

How to convert quarts to fluid ounces?

To convert quarts to fluid ounces, multiply the quart value by 32. For example, to find out how many fluid ounces there are in 2 quarts, multiply 32 by 2, that makes 64 fluid ounces in 2 quarts.

What is a quart?

The quart is a US customary unit of volume. Quarts can be abbreviated as qt; for example, 1 quart can be written as 1 qt.

How many cups are in a quart?

The US liquid quart is a unit of fluid volume equal to one fourth of a gallon, two pints, or four cups . The liquid quart should not be confused with the dry quart (US) or the imperial quart, which are different units.

What is fluid ounce?

The fluid ounce is a US customary unit of volume. Fluid ounces can be abbreviated as fl oz, and are also sometimes abbreviated as fl. oz. or oz. fl.. For example, 1 fluid ounce can be written as 1 fl oz, 1 fl. oz., or 1 oz. fl..
